Funkce Lower, Upper a Proper v Power Apps
Převedou písmena v textovém řetězci na všechna malá písmena, na všechna velká písmena nebo na první velká písmena slov.
Popis
Funkce Lower, Upper a Proper převádějí velikost písmen v řetězcích.
- Funkce Lower převede všechna velká písmena na malá.
- Funkce Upper převede všechna malá písmena na velká.
- Funkce Proper převede první písmeno (pokud je malé) každého slova na velké a všechna ostatní velká písmena na malá.
Všechny tři funkce ignorují znaky, které nejsou písmeny.
Pokud předáte jeden řetězec, návratovou hodnotou je převedená verze tohoto řetězce. Pokud předáte tabulku s jedním sloupcem, která obsahuje řetězce, bude návratovou hodnotou jednosloupcová tabulka převedených řetězců. Pokud máte tabulku s více sloupci, převeďte ji na tabulku s jedním sloupcem, jak je popsáno v části popisující práci s tabulkami.
Syntaxe
Lower( Řetězec )
Upper( Řetězec )
Proper( Řetězec )
- Řetězec - povinné. Řetězec, který chcete převést.
Lower( TabulkaSJednímSloupcem )
Upper( TabulkaSJednímSloupcem )
Proper( TabulkaSJednímSloupcem )
- TabulkaSJednímSloupcem – povinné. Tabulka s jedním sloupcem obsahující řetězce, které chcete převést.
Příklady
Jeden řetězec
Příklady v této části používají jako zdroj dat ovládací prvek Text input s názvem Autor. Tento ovládací prvek obsahuje řetězec "E. E. CummINGS".
| Vzorec | Popis | Výsledek |
|---|---|---|
| Lower( Autor.Text ) | Převede všechna velká písmena v řetězci na malá. | "e. e. cummings" |
| Upper( Autor.Text ) | Převede všechna malá písmena v řetězci na velká. | "E. E. CUMMINGS" |
| Proper( Autor.Text ) | Převede první písmeno (pokud je malé) každého slova na velké a všechna ostatní velká písmena na malá. | "E. E. Cummings" |
Tabulka s jedním sloupcem
Příklady v této části převádějí řetězce ze sloupce Address (Adresa) zdroje dat People (Lidé), který obsahuje tato data:

Každý vzorec vrátí tabulku s jedním sloupcem, která obsahuje převedené řetězce.
| Vzorec | Popis | Výsledek |
|---|---|---|
| Lower( ShowColumns( People; "Address" ) ) | Převede všechna velká písmena na malá. | ![]() |
| Upper( ShowColumns( People; "Address" ) ) | Převede všechna velká písmena na malá. | ![]() |
| Proper( ShowColumns( People; "Address" ) ) | Převede první písmeno (pokud je malé) každého slova na velké a všechna ostatní velká písmena na malá. | ![]() |
Podrobný příklad
- Přidejte ovládací prvek Text input a pojmenujte ho Zdroj.
- Přidejte popisek a jeho vlastnost Text nastavte na tuto funkci:
Proper(Zdroj.Text) - Stiskněte klávesu F5 a zadejte text WE ARE THE CHAMPIONS! do pole Zdroj.
V popisku se zobrazí We Are The Champions!
Poznámka
Můžete nám sdělit, jaké máte jazykové preference pro dokumentaci? Zúčastněte se krátkého průzkumu. (upozorňujeme, že tento průzkum je v angličtině)
Průzkum bude trvat asi sedm minut. Nejsou shromažďovány žádné osobní údaje (prohlášení o zásadách ochrany osobních údajů).
Váš názor
Odeslat a zobrazit názory pro


